Default Free Working GPS?

I was browsing online some time ago trying to find an actual working GPS for the Storm, but had no luck.
I remember reading that Verizon actually blocks any GPS other than their own.
I recently read a post here saying that Nav4All was able to work but I still can't get it to pick up the satellite.
Does anyone here know a solution for this? I'd really appreciate it. BB Maps just isn't the same thing.
Thanx in advance.

Make sure your GPS is turned on. You can check by going to

options-> Advanced options -> GPS

Make sure GPS services is set to "Location ON" and Location Aiding is enabled. Enjoy!

After making sure you GPS is on (see post #2) give Nav4All a few minutes the first time to find satellites. It took mine a little while. Also, make sure you are somewhere that has a relatively good view of the sky.

Mmmm...sort of. Google maps works fine with the GPS in the Storm if you are in a location that uses GSM instead of CDMA (i.e. Europe). I'm fairly certain that the problem is that Google Maps is trying to look at A-GPS...which Verizon locks. Verizon could fix it by giving Google the unlock codes or Google could fix it by looking at straight GPS data instead of A-GPS.
